Highlights
Are people in Hood River older or younger than people in Sumner?
- The Median Age in Hood River is 0.5 years older than in Sumner.

Are housing costs cheaper in Hood River or Sumner?
- Hood River housing costs are 21.7% more expensive than Sumner hous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Hood River or Sumner?
- The average commute for residents of Hood River is 11.6 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Sumner.

Things to do in Sumner?
Sumner is a city located in Pierce County, Washington and part of the Seattle metropolitan area. It was incorporated in 1890 and has grown to become home to several large industries such as Sumner Mountain Gristmill, Blythewood Nursery & Garden Center & Sumner Bakery. The city also boasts plenty of outdoor activities like golfing at Sunset Links Golf Course or fishing and swimming at Wickersham Pond Nature Park.

Things to do in Hood River?
Living in Hood River, OR is an incredible experience! The city is nestled on the Columbia River Gorge, offering stunning views of nearby Mt. Hood and the Cascade Mountains. There are plenty of outdoor activities to choose from, such as hiking and fishing, while the downtown area has plenty of restaurants and shops to explore.
